作者GoliathPlus (Taiwan Yes !)
看板Web_Design
标题Re: [PHP]表单传送到哪去了?
时间Mon Sep 13 13:44:06 2004
※ 引述《GoliathPlus (Taiwan Yes !)》之铭言:
: ※ 引述《broslovski (宝)》之铭言:
: : 我的server有支援php
: : 那就是说在mail函数内插入我设计的表单
: : 就可以了吗?
: 要支援smtp
: 也就是你的server要有mail server
: 否则信是寄不出去的
: 你可以问一下管server的人有没有支援
不然你试一下这段code好了
可以寄就可以
$mail_to的值改为要寄去的mail address
<?PHP
$reciever = $HTTP_GET_VARS['reciever']; //建议以学号为index
$mail_to = "
[email protected]"; // get e-mail address from database
if ( isset($HTTP_POST_VARS['mail_sub']) && isset($HTTP_POST_VARS['mail_content'
]
))
{
if (mail ($mail_to,$mail_sub,$mail_content))
{
echo "信件已寄出 Mail sent";
}
else
{
echo "传送失败 Failure";
}
}
else
{
?>
<html>
<head>
<title>信箱隐藏讯息</title>
</head>
<body>
<p>Send To:<?PHP echo $reciever; ?></p>
<form action="mailto.php" method="post" name="form1" id="form1">
<table width="500" border="1" cellspacing="2" bordercolor="#3333FF">
<tr>
<td width="85" bgcolor="#3366CC"> <div align="center"><strong><font color
=
"#FF6633">Title</font>
</strong></div></td>
<td bgcolor="#66FFCC" ><input name="mail_sub" type="text" id="mail_sub2"
size="80" maxlength="80"></td>
</tr>
<tr>
<td colspan="2"> <textarea name="mail_content" id="mail_content" cols="80
"
rows="10">请将讯息留在此处</textarea>
</td>
</tr>
<tr>
<tr align="left">
<td colspan="2">
<input name="Submit" type="submit" id="Submit" value="发送" >
</td>
</tr>
</table>
</form>
</body>
</html>
<?php
}
?>
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 140.113.151.64